Away from the loungers, cocktails, and markets, the Costa del Sol offers a range of adrenaline-fueled experiences for thrillseekers. From soaring through the skies to rapidly driving down dirt paths, this popular holiday destination offers much more than tasty food and stunning views.
One of the standout activities is ziplining at Sunview Park in Alhaurín de la Torre. Measuring 1,350 meters, it is the longest zipline in Andalusia and the second longest in Spain, reaching speeds of up to 100 km/h while offering panoramic views of fields and mountains. The experience includes a "superman" pose flight and a subsequent Land Rover ride through mountain tracks.
Near Mijas Pueblo, ATV Adventures offers quad biking tours through mountain trails. Participants navigate natural landscapes, spot local flora, and enjoy downhill rides and puddle crossings, guided by experts who share facts about the Sierra de Mijas geography. A change of clothes is recommended due to mud and water.
The adventure continues with canyoning in the Guadalmina river, organized by Marbella Adventures. This three-hour activity combines jumps, climbing, and swimming in a natural environment of cliffs and rock slides. Licensed guides provide access to otherwise inaccessible areas, allowing participants to enjoy local wildlife and culminating in a six-meter abseil descent.
